Understanding Registered Agents and Their Importance
A registered agent is an individual or an organization that is assigned to get important legal documents and government notices on behalf of a company. This includes documents such as legal notices, tax notifications, and annual filing reminders. Having a registered agent is a requirement in most states for companies and limited liability entities. The registered agent serves as the entity's official point of contact with state regulators, ensuring that all communication is handled efficiently and in accordance with legal obligations.
The role of a registered agent goes beyond mere document collection. They also provide services that help businesses maintain adherence with state laws, including monitoring due dates for filing necessary documents and ensuring that all statutory obligations are met. This support can be extremely beneficial for business owners who may not have the knowledge or resources to manage these responsibilities on their own. By hiring a reliable registered agent, companies can direct their efforts towards their core operations while leaving the complexities of legal compliance to professionals.

Registered Agent Obligations and Expenses
When establishing a business structure such as a company, particular registered agent requirements need to be fulfilled. Typically, a registered agent is required to be a resident of the state where the business is formed or a corporation licensed to do business in that state. In addition to residency, the registered agent should be accessible during normal hours to receive legal documents and legal notices on behalf of the business. Various states may have unique regulations regarding the criteria, so it is crucial for entrepreneurs to examine local laws to ensure conformity.
The expenses involved in hiring a registered agent can differ greatly based on the scope of services and the firm chosen. Fundamental registered agent services are typically provided for a fee ranging from $50 to three hundred dollars per year. Nonetheless, supplementary services such as handling of business correspondence, compliance notifications, and records storage can increase the final price. It is recommended for business owners to consider not only the price but also the trustworthiness and credibility of the registered agent company when making their choice.

Methods to Change The Registered Agent
Changing the registered agent can be a clear-cut process that helps to ensure your business remains compliant to state regulations. Initially, you’ll need to choose a fresh registered agent provider that satisfies your business necessities. It is crucial to important to pick a trustworthy registered agent company which offers the required services and can properly process legal documents and service of process. Make sure to weigh factors like cost, availability, and customer reviews when arriving at the decision.
When you have selected a different registered agent, one must have to inform your current registered agent of the change following state regulations. Once you inform your existing agent, you need to complete the essential paperwork to formally change your registered agent. This typically involves filling out a registered agent change form, that can usually be found on the state’s business filing website. Ensure to check all registered agent requirements specific to the state to confirm compliance.
In conclusion, submit the filled out form along with any required fees to the correct state office. After the submission, one should get confirmation of the change, which is important for the records and for maintaining compliance with annual requirements. Keeping track of one's registered agent renewal and ensuring timely updates protects one's business from potential legal issues.
